What is a Fire Entry Suit?

Essentially, a Fire Entry Suit is a robust, heat-resistant outfit crafted to keep the wearer safe in extreme heat and fiery environments. Made from high-tech materials like Nomex and Kevlar, these suits are designed to withstand temperatures that would make most people flee in terror!

Key Features of Fire Entry Suits

Alright, let's break it down! Fire Entry Suits come packed with features that make them not just protective but also functional:

  • Thermal Protection: These suits offer top-notch insulation, keeping wearers cool while they tackle flames.
  • Water Resistance: Many Fire Entry Suits are designed to repel water, preventing steam burns in high-humidity situations.
  • Durability: Constructed to last, these suits can endure the wear and tear of rugged firefighting environments.
  • Visibility: Bright colors and reflective strips ensure that firefighters are visible, even in smoke-filled conditions.

Choosing the Right Fire Entry Suit

Shopping for a Fire Entry Suit? Here's a quick checklist to ensure you get the most bang for your buck:

  • Certification: Look for suits that meet safety standards like NFPA (National Fire Protection Association) ratings.
  • Fit: Make sure it fits well—not too tight, not too loose!
  • Material: Opt for high-quality materials that can withstand extreme conditions.
